Good amount synonyms are words and phrases that mean a nice or enough quantity. In very simple English, good amount means not too little and not too much. When you learn good amount synonyms, your writing feels fresh and strong.
Plenty
Meaning: More than enough.
Examples:
- We have plenty of food.
- She has plenty of time.
Enough
Meaning: As much as needed.
Examples:
- I have enough money.
- That is enough rice.
A Lot
Meaning: A large amount.
Examples:
- He has a lot of books.
- It rained a lot.
